Software Development Engineer, Embedded Systems

1 month ago


Dongguan, Guangdong, China HARMAN International Full time

Company Overview


HARMAN International is a global leader in connected car and enterprise solutions. Our company is dedicated to creating innovative technologies that improve people's lives.


About the Role


We are seeking an experienced Software Development Engineer to join our team. As a key member of our engineering department, you will be responsible for developing and maintaining software applications for our embedded systems.


Responsibilities


Your primary responsibilities will include:



  • Designing, developing, testing, and deploying software applications for our embedded systems
  • Collaborating with cross-functional teams to identify and prioritize project requirements
  • Maintaining and enhancing existing software applications to ensure they meet the evolving needs of our customers
  • Providing technical support and guidance to colleagues as needed

Requirements


To be successful in this role, you will need:



  • Bachelor's degree in Electrical, Electronic Engineering, Computer Science, or equivalent
  • 5+ years of experience in embedded software development
  • Strong understanding of C and C++ programming languages
  • Experience with Linux operating system and TCP/IP protocol stack
  • Familiarity with Ethernet and Wi-Fi technologies
  • Basic hardware knowledge and understanding of hardware schematic
  • Excellent written and oral communication skills in English

Preferred Qualifications


Awarded candidates will have experience in:



  • UART/I2C/SPI/USB driver development and troubleshooting
  • Makefile and CMake scripting
  • Yocto or Buildroot development
  • Audio product development (e.g., Wi-Fi speaker/soundbar) and BlueDroid porting
  • Linux ALSA and GStreamer development

What We Offer


We are proud to offer a competitive salary range of $120,000 - $180,000 per year, depending on experience, plus a comprehensive benefits package, including medical, dental, and vision insurance, 401(k) matching, and paid time off.


HARMAN is an Equal Opportunity Employer


All qualified applicants will receive consideration for employment without regard to race, religion, color, national origin, gender (including pregnancy, childbirth, or related medical conditions), sexual orientation, gender identity, gender expression, age, status as a protected veteran, status as an individual with a disability, or other applicable legally protected characteristics.



  • Dongguan, Guangdong, China HARMAN International Full time

    Job OverviewHARMAN International is seeking a highly skilled and experienced Senior Embedded Software Development Manager to join our team. This role will be based in Shenzhen, China.ResponsibilitiesLead the development of embedded software for various HARMAN products, ensuring timely delivery and high quality standards.Collaborate with cross-functional...


  • Dongguan, Guangdong, China Carrier Full time

    Job Title: Embedded Firmware EngineerAbout the Job:The Embedded Firmware Engineer will be responsible for designing, implementing, and maintaining Fire Alarm Sensors and Devices from specification through production. Emphasis is on embedded firmware design, project completion, engineering documentation, and product agency...


  • Dongguan, Guangdong, China Renesas Electronics Full time

    Embedded Software and Tools Enablement RoleWe are seeking a talented Engineer to join our Product Marketing team, focusing on enabling MCU and MPU software and tools. The successful candidate will develop strategies for combining external partner solutions with our internal software and technologies.Key Responsibilities:Develop and execute technical...


  • Dongguan, Guangdong, China Qualcomm Full time

    Unlock Your Career Potential as a Senior Embedded SW EngineerWe are seeking an experienced and skilled Senior Embedded SW Engineer to join our Engineering Group, specifically in the Software Engineering department. As a key member of our team, you will be responsible for developing software for IOT devices, with a focus on camera-related...


  • Dongguan, Guangdong, China Valeo Full time

    Valeo, a global tech company, is revolutionizing mobility with innovative solutions. As a leader in the automotive industry, we're recognized for our cutting-edge technology and commitment to sustainability. Our team is passionate about designing and developing breakthrough solutions that enhance driving experiences and reduce CO2 emissions.About the...


  • Dongguan, Guangdong, China Lenovo Full time

    Job SummaryLenovo seeks a skilled Software Development Engineer for AI Systems to contribute to the development of AI-powered software solutions. As a key member of our engineering team, you will be responsible for designing, implementing, and testing AI systems that drive innovation and excellence in the field.ResponsibilitiesCollaborate with...


  • Dongguan, Guangdong, China HARMAN International Full time

    About the RoleHARMAN's engineers and designers are creative, purposeful and agile. As part of this team, you'll combine your technical expertise with innovative ideas to help drive cutting-edge solutions in the car, enterprise and connected ecosystem.Every day, you will push the boundaries of creative design, and HARMAN is committed to providing you with the...

  • Software Architect

    1 month ago


    Dongguan, Guangdong, China Philips Full time

    Job DescriptionAs a Software Architect - IoT Product Development Lead, you will have the opportunity to work on Mother & Child Care new developments specifically for our latest innovations part of our digital parenting platform.Your Key Responsibilities:Translate user and product requirements into software requirements;Create software architecture in line...


  • Dongguan, Guangdong, China Bosch Full time

    Job DescriptionAt Bosch, we are seeking a skilled Automation Software Engineer to join our team. In this role, you will be responsible for developing process sequences in LabWindows CVI for automation machines. You will lead equipment engineers to complete MAEs, including defining cause and effect requirements, designing, processing, and MAEs. Additionally,...


  • Dongguan, Guangdong, China LMI Technologies Full time

    Job DescriptionWe are seeking an experienced Computer Vision Software Engineer to join our Solutions Team at LMI Technologies. As a key member of our team, you will apply your machine vision and data processing expertise to create innovative 3D measurement tools and inspection applications.ResponsibilitiesDevelop high-performance inspection applications...


  • Dongguan, Guangdong, China HARMAN International Full time

    OverviewHARMAN International is a global leader in connected technologies for automotive, consumer and enterprise markets. We are committed to delivering innovative, connected solutions that enhance the lives of people around the world.


  • Dongguan, Guangdong, China Lenovo Full time

    Company OverviewWe are Lenovo, a global technology leader. Our mission is to create innovative and high-quality products that empower our customers to achieve their goals.SalaryThe estimated salary for this position is $120,000 per year, commensurate with experience.Job DescriptionAs a Database Systems Engineer at Lenovo, you will be responsible for...


  • Dongguan, Guangdong, China Renesas Electronics Full time

    Unlock the Future of ElectronicsRenesas is a leading global semiconductor company, and we're on a mission to create a safer, healthier, greener, and smarter world. As a Strategic Marketing Engineer, you'll play a crucial role in shaping our product solutions for the automotive, industrial, infrastructure, and IoT markets.We're seeking a highly skilled...


  • Dongguan, Guangdong, China Lumentum Full time

    Job SummaryLumentum seeks an experienced Automation Software Principal Engineer to lead the development of cutting-edge automation solutions. As a visionary innovator, you will drive the design and implementation of complex automation software systems, leveraging expertise in LABVIEW programming language.


  • Dongguan, Guangdong, China Carrier Full time

    About CarrierCarrier is a leading company in the field of fire alarm systems, providing innovative solutions to protect people and properties.


  • Dongguan, Guangdong, China Philips Full time

    Job Title: System Integration EngineerAbout the Role:This is a highly technical position that involves overseeing the integration of various systems to ensure seamless functionality. The ideal candidate will have expertise in system integration, product development, and technical leadership.Key Responsibilities:- Develop and implement system integration...


  • Dongguan, Guangdong, China Philips Full time

    Job OverviewAs a Senior Systems Integration Engineer at Philips, you will be responsible for translating business and user requirements into product requirements, developing the System Integration plan, and driving System Integration and verification activities. You will also be developing and following up on the product design FMEA that feeds into the...


  • Dongguan, Guangdong, China Molex Full time

    Job Summary:Molex is seeking a skilled Automation Systems Specialist to join our team. The ideal candidate will have a strong background in mechanical design and automation engineering, with experience in working independently on automation equipment design and manufacturing.Key Responsibilities:Design and develop automation equipment and systems for...


  • Dongguan, Guangdong, China Allegro MicroSystems Full time

    About the RoleWe are seeking an experienced Electrical Engineering Expert to join our team in Shanghai. As a System Engineer, you will play a key role in developing and supporting our sensor IC product lines.Key Responsibilities:Provide technical support to customers working with our sales and field applications engineers.Work closely with other applications...


  • Dongguan, Guangdong, China HARMAN International Full time

    HARMAN International is a leading technology company that specializes in connected solutions for automotive, consumer and enterprise markets.We are currently seeking an experienced Software Engineer to lead our software development efforts. As a Principal Engineer, you will be responsible for defining the technology roadmap, maintaining master requirements,...